Heat is working fine! The noise is just bothering me. Did 09s and 10s have a different location for the driver side actuator? I swear mine is coming from behind the nav screen on my 12

SALEEN961 02-14-2019 01:35 AM

They seem to be the same from 09-14. Trucks with dual zone climate control will have a driver side temp actuator, but single zone trucks will not. If you have one it will be just above the floor at the very bottom of the HVAC box in the center of the dash, this is the only one that's hard to replace, but if you aren't too concerned with cutting corners, there are some short cuts to save several hours, Fordtechmakuloco did a video on these and how to cut the time way down.

You shouldn't judge this on noise, but on function. There are 4 actuators, I think they can all sound pretty much the same when clicking. Driver temp, Passenger temp, Source (outside/recirc), Inside distribution. You should be able to fiddle a bit and figure out which function is bad.
